Example sentences for: stately

How can you use “stately” in a sentence? Here are some example sentences to help you improve your vocabulary:

  • At the top of a sloping driveway, the stately Edwardian structure that was the original university building presides over the institution’s newer buildings.

  • It stands on a raised platform, its profile stately against the sky.

  • The only difference is that, in Hugo's original writings, the wordy rhymed couplets conjure a feeling of endless verbal ingenuity, advancing majestically at a stately pace--whereas, with the lyricists' committee at Les Mis , everything rushes forward pell-mell, as always in modern Broadway productions, and clichés tread on one another's heels, and you have this feeling of a hidden stage director crying, "Next!

  • The stately pedalo for two won’t go fast, and it’s stable enough for adults to take small children with them.

  • Moving outward from the center, one passes from stately, ornamental 16th-century apartment buildings with shuttered windows, wrought-iron balconies, and brick facades to the Baroque palaces of the Bourbons, and later Neo-classical buildings meant to convey authority.
